Reference excerpt

Silver sulfate is an inorganic compound with the formula Ag2SO4. It is a white solid with low solubility in water.

Preparation and structure

Silver sulfate precipitates when an aqueous solution of silver nitrate is treated with sulfuric acid:

2 AgNO3 + H2SO4 → Ag2SO4 + 2 HNO3 It is purified by recrystallization from concentrated sulfuric acid, a step that expels traces of nitrate. Silver sulfate and anhydrous sodium sulfate adopt the same structure.
